The mission of the Office of Academic Technology (OAT) is to lead a strategic and holistic academic technology ecosystem where students, faculty and staff thrive. The OAT strategically guides the adoption and implementation of academic technologies that foster the achievement of learning outcomes while simultaneously ensuring privacy, accessibility, data security, streamlined technology spend and digital literacy on campus.
